The Inner Chimp doesn’t always look (or feel) the same.
In creating my designs I’ve referenced the ‘Mood Meter’ which uses colour to depict specific emotions. For example, Yellow could be excited, Green – calm & relaxed, Blue – sad, Red – nervous, anxious or angry. Or you could be a mix of colours, if you’re not quite sure how you’re feeling!

GROWTH MINDSETS
Also created for Henleaze Junior School, a set of 4 illustrated artworks to help support their teaching of Growth Mindsets, again for Key Stage 2 children (age 7-11)
The school had been using the idea of a Yeti as a way to help describe the various elements of a Growth Mindset, and wanted to build on this – “I may not be able to do something…YET!”
It was fun to develop the Yeti character, and he really helps bring the individual statements to life in a friendly way, making it easier for the children to remember.
